Jala Maeleigh Odell

January 17, 2012

Funeral for Jada Maeleigh Odell, 1, of Hartselle will be Fri., Jan. 20, at 1 p.m. at Christ Fellowship Church with the Rev. Danny Garrison officiating and Peck Funeral Home directing.

Visitation will be Fri., Jan. 20, form 11 a.m. to 1 p.m. at the church

Burial will be in New Center Cemetery.

Jada died Tues., Jan. 17, 2012, at Lawrence County Medical Center. She was born Oct. 3, 2010, in Morgan County to Nathaniel Lee Odell and Devin McKenzie Bates Odell. She was preceded in death by her grandparents, Milton Garrison, Martha Jones and Elsworth Bates.

She is survived by her parents, Nathaniel Lee Odell and Devin McKenzie Bates Odell of Hartselle; an aunt, Angel Odell; four uncles, Dustin Bates and wife Maria, Tyler Bates and wife Montana, Buddy Odell Jr. and wife Sharonda and Christopher Odell; three cousins, Kursten Odell, Brodie Odell and Nevaeh Odell; her grandparents, Michael and Teresa Bates of Hartselle, Eerie Hill and George Hill of Moulton and Buddy Odell Sr. of Courtland; and her great-grandparents, Laverne Garrison, Colleen Reeves and Alton and Joyce Hill, all of Hartselle and Dessie Vandiver of Danville.
